I visited “The Bear and Staff” for a pie and pint on 7th March 2024. I was not provided with a written bill and I was charged £32.01 which I paid by credit card. Customers should always be provided with a written bill clearly showing a breakdown of what they are being expected to pay. After leaving the pub, I realised that £32.01 was VERY EXPENSIVE for just a pie and pint. I did not have time to return to “The Bear and Staff” and I therefore e-mailed them the next morning. At least to their credit, I did receive a response to the first of my e-mails from “Phil” although he then totally ignored my follow-up e-mails to question the following. This is very poor customer service when I had legitimate comments and questions. Whilst the pie came with included carrots and mashed potato, I was told that there was a £4 “add on” for broccoli. Apart from being exceptionally expensive for just a few pieces of broccoli, I am wondering why some vegetables are included whilst others are deemed to be an “add on”. Furthermore, I did not specifically request broccoli and I was not advised that this as an “add on” would incur an additional cost of £4. This should be made clear to customers. I was also told that there was an “optional service charge” of 10%. Whilst I may have been happy to pay this, again I was not advised that there was a “service charge” and that I had an “option” to pay it. It was therefore not “optional” but effectively mandatory. This should also be made clear to customers. All this makes my £32.01 bill for a pie and pint extremely poor value for money and therefore I will not consider “The Bear and Staff” again should I need to eat in this area of London. No doubt “Phil” will claim here following this review that these hidden charges are transparently stated to customers. They are quite clearly not! Warning to potential future customers …. Always demand a written bill and check everything that you have been charged for!

We ate ate this pub/restaurant almost by default. We had intended getting a bus from The Strand back to Marble Arch, but due to a demonstration in Trafalgar Square area, the area from there and up The Strand was completely gridlocked. We therefore walked down Charing Cross Road and both of us being tired and footsore after a long day in the Capital, came across The Bear and Staff. We looked at the menu and decided we would give it a try. The restaurant area is upstairs away from the hubbub of the main pub area. The menu was pretty basic pub grub which suited us. We both had fish - my husband the Haddock and chips and I had the salmon dish. Both were piping hot and very tasty. There was no undue greasiness of my husband's plate when he had finished. My salmon dish was full of flavour. Afterwards we did not want one of the heavier "puddings" so we asked if we could just have a portion of ice cream each so that is what we had. The service was good and the ambience serene. There were a handful of other customers in a not that large area, well spaced out and everything was Covid secure. Very happy with our choice. Will visit this or another Nicholson pub/restaurant in the future - competitive prices too. We did not leave a tip as there was a 10% service charge levied, otherwise we would have done and that would probably have equated to the service charge in any case.
